Overview

Ethanolic fraction of neem leaf (EFNL) is a botanical extract derived from the leaves of the neem tree (*Azadirachta indica*). Developed primarily by researchers at the Texas Tech University Health Sciences Center, EFNL is being investigated for its potential antineoplastic properties, particularly in the treatment of breast cancer, including estrogen receptor-positive (ER+) and triple-negative breast cancer (TNBC). EFNL exerts its anticancer effects by inducing the generation of reactive oxygen species (ROS), which subsequently inhibits the phosphorylation and activation of pro-survival signaling pathways, including Akt, mTOR, and NF-κB. Additionally, EFNL treatment has been shown to upregulate pro-apoptotic proteins such as p53, Bax, Bad, caspases, and PTEN, while downregulating anti-apoptotic proteins (Bcl-2), angiogenic factors (VEGF-A, angiopoietin), and cell cycle regulators (cyclin D1, CDK2, CDK4).
